Should you play it?
Enjoy an unforgettable blast from the past with this classic real-time strategy experience. This all-inclusive bundle includes the original 22 missions from State of War (2000), and 16 additional missions from its sequel, State of War: Warmonger (2003).
What works
- Unique rts mechanics without base building
- Challenging and strategic gameplay
- Nostalgic and charming sci-fi setting
- Includes original and expansion campaigns
- Level editor and modding support
Things to keep in mind
- Dated graphics and sound
- Slow gameplay pace
- Limited multiplayer support
- Some ui and control limitations
- Occasional bugs and crashes
